Python安装支持MySQL模块教程

引言

Python是一种功能强大且易于学习的编程语言,在数据处理和Web开发领域广受欢迎。如果你想在Python中使用MySQL数据库,你需要安装并配置MySQL模块。本教程将教会你如何在Python中安装和配置MySQL模块。

整体流程

下面是安装和配置MySQL模块的整体流程:

步骤 描述
步骤 1 安装Python
步骤 2 安装MySQL数据库
步骤 3 安装Python的MySQL模块
步骤 4 配置MySQL连接信息
步骤 5 在Python代码中使用MySQL模块

接下来,我们将一步步详细说明每个步骤需要做什么。

步骤 1:安装Python

在开始之前,你需要确保你已经安装了Python。你可以从官方网站(

步骤 2:安装MySQL数据库

在使用Python的MySQL模块之前,你需要先安装MySQL数据库。你可以从MySQL官方网站(

步骤 3:安装Python的MySQL模块

安装完MySQL数据库后,你需要安装Python的MySQL模块。你可以使用以下命令在命令行中安装:

pip install mysql-connector-python

这个命令会自动下载并安装Python的MySQL模块。

步骤 4:配置MySQL连接信息

在开始使用MySQL模块之前,你需要配置MySQL连接信息。你可以在Python代码中使用以下代码配置连接信息:

import mysql.connector

mydb = mysql.connector.connect(
  host="localhost",
  user="yourusername",
  password="yourpassword",
  database="yourdatabase"
)

print(mydb)

在上面的代码中,你需要将localhost替换为你的MySQL服务器主机名,yourusername替换为你的MySQL用户名,yourpassword替换为你的MySQL密码,yourdatabase替换为你要连接的数据库名称。这个代码片段会创建一个MySQL连接对象。

步骤 5:在Python代码中使用MySQL模块

现在你已经安装了MySQL模块并配置了连接信息,你可以在Python代码中使用MySQL模块进行数据库操作。以下是一个简单的例子:

import mysql.connector

mydb = mysql.connector.connect(
  host="localhost",
  user="yourusername",
  password="yourpassword",
  database="yourdatabase"
)

mycursor = mydb.cursor()

mycursor.execute("CREATE TABLE customers (name VARCHAR(255), address VARCHAR(255))")

mycursor.execute("INSERT INTO customers (name, address) VALUES (%s, %s)", ("John", "Highway 21"))

mydb.commit()

print(mycursor.rowcount, "record inserted.")

在上面的代码中,我们首先创建了一个名为customers的表,并插入了一条记录。最后,我们提交了更改,并打印了插入的记录数。

旅行图

journey
    title Python安装支持MySQL模块教程

    section 安装Python
    section 安装MySQL数据库
    section 安装Python的MySQL模块
    section 配置MySQL连接信息
    section 在Python代码中使用MySQL模块

状态图

stateDiagram
    [*] --> 安装Python
    安装Python --> 安装MySQL数据库
    安装MySQL数据库 --> 安装Python的MySQL模块
    安装Python的MySQL模块 --> 配置MySQL连接信息
    配置MySQL连接信息 --> 在Python代码中使用MySQL模块
    在Python代码中使用MySQL模块 --> [*]

结论

通过按照以上步骤,你已经成功地安装了Python的MySQL模块,并配置了MySQL连接信息。现在你可以在Python代码中使用MySQL模块进行数据库操作。希望这篇教程对你有帮助!